This half-day event will include service partners in three categories:
-
Restorative: Includes hot meals, snacks, fresh fruit, and water. Other products distributed will be hygiene kits, clothes (to include attire for interviewing), supplies, and haircuts.
-
Advancement: These services remove barriers and help people take a step forward by providing opportunities to improve health and wellness in addition to educational and employment services.
-
Community services: These services include medical health screenings, wound care, foot care, vaccinations, dental, and vision support. We will provide wellness professionals who will lead the community in mind exercise and meditation-stress relief tips.
Other services and activities that will be provided at this event are:
-
Employment: Onsite resume help, printing, interviewing assistance and an interviewing outfit. Employment assistance for those with criminal history.
-
Medicaid/Medicare assistance.
-
Educational Opportunities: TCC will promote their visions unlimited program.
-
Vet/Animal Services: For those with animals to include dog food, flea collars etc.
-
Music, art, group exercises, motivational speakers, mentor groups, barbers, hair stylists, nail technicians, games for the kids, photo booth, carnival games and lots of snacks!
